Publisher Description

The Book of Haggai is set in the reign of Darius, king of the Persian Empire following the Babylonian Captivity that began in 586 BC. The prophet is concerned with rebuilding the Temple in order to restore devotion to the LORD and bringing moral and social structure to Israel. The ancient message of Haggai offers a practical message for the modern world.
